SpaceX’s IPO expected to create 4,000 new millionaires, including cafeteria workers

SpaceX's anticipated IPO could create approximately 4,000 new millionaires among its workforce, including non-executive employees such as cafeteria workers. This wealth creation event has implications for local economies, wealth distribution patterns, and financial services demand in aerospace and tech sectors.

Analysis

SpaceX's path to going public represents a significant liquidity event for a private aerospace company that has accumulated substantial employee equity over its operational history. The potential creation of 4,000 millionaires demonstrates how concentrated wealth in high-growth private companies distributes across organizational hierarchies when companies exit to public markets. This includes not only engineers and executives but also support staff, reflecting the broad-based equity compensation strategies many tech and aerospace firms employ to retain talent in competitive labor markets.

The aerospace sector has historically produced fewer IPO-driven wealth events compared to software and internet companies, making a SpaceX public offering noteworthy for industry precedent. The company's success in commercial spaceflight, government contracts, and satellite infrastructure has created genuine underlying value rather than speculative positioning. This contrasts with earlier tech bubbles where employee wealth creation often proved ephemeral.

For local economies near SpaceX facilities, sudden millionaire creation accelerates spending in real estate, services, and consumer goods. Regional financial institutions will compete for wealth management business from newly liquid employees. The event may also influence employee recruitment and retention strategies across the aerospace and defense sectors, as competitors recognize equity compensation's wealth-creation potential.

Market observers should monitor the IPO timeline, valuation metrics, and post-listing stock performance as indicators of broader aerospace sector health. The distribution of wealth creation across employee tiers may also influence policy discussions around equity compensation and worker financial security in high-growth industries.
